About
Jennifer A. McCabe leads a Santa Cruz County family law practice focused on family law litigation and mediation, including divorce and child custody matters. She previously served as an Administrative Adjudication Hearing Officer for the Institute for Administrative Justice, and earlier in her career worked in intellectual property law, employment law, and personal injury litigation.

Do I need a divorce lawyer?
While you can represent yourself, having a lawyer is highly recommended, especially with children, significant assets, or contested issues. A lawyer ensures your rights are protected.
What should I bring to my first consultation?
Bring financial documents (tax returns, bank statements, pay stubs), property records, prenuptial agreements if applicable, and a list of questions and concerns about your situation.
